What's The Definition Of Ashamed?Synonyms | Synonyms for Ashamed: Related Terms | Find terms related to Ashamed: abashed | abject | blushing | chagrined | chapfallen | conscience-smitten | conscience-stricken | contrite | crestfallen | crushed | discomfited | embarrassed | full of remorse | hangdog | humbled | humiliated | mean | mortified | out of countenance | penitent | red-faced | regretful | remorseful | repentant | repining | rueful | self-accusing | self-condemning | self-convicting | self-debasing | self-flagellating | self-humiliating | self-punishing | self-reproaching | shamed | shamefaced | shamefast | shameful | sheepish | sorry | unhappy about | wistful See Also | Ashamed In Webster's Dictionary \A*shamed"\, a. [Orig. a p. p. of ashame, v. t.]
Affected by shame; abashed or confused by guilt, or a
conviction or consciousness of some wrong action or
impropriety. ``I am ashamed to beg.'' --Wyclif.
All that forsake thee shall be ashamed. --Jer. xvii.
13.
I began to be ashamed of sitting idle. --Johnson.
Enough to make us ashamed of our species. --Macaulay.
An ashamed person can hardly endure to meet the gaze of
those present. --Darwin.
Note: Ashamed seldom precedes the noun or pronoun it
qualifies. By a Hebraism, it is sometimes used in the
Bible to mean disappointed, or defeated.
